I'm in need of a replacement dial knob for the Nord Drum 3P in the UK, anyone any ideas were I would get one, or know what kind of replacement knob would work?

If the pot/encoder itself is broken, I'd not try to repair it myself. If it's only the plastic part, I'd still first try through a Nord dealer/distributor to get an 'official' replacement, but you can also check alternatives, you have to know what size and type of shaft you'll need, stores like Thonk and Banzai have all sorts of synth knobs but perhaps not the right color/shape.
